ADSL users have recently experienced problems with
their ADSL Broadband connections caused by a combination of factors: Cable theft, power outages, thunderstorms,
broken submarine cables, et cetera. In this article we will look at comical as well as ‘serious ways’ to prevent
those teething ADSL Broadband problems from surfacing
again.
Cable
theft…
This is a tough one at best because it’s clear that we’re sitting
with many ‘copper grabbers’ in South Africa that are more than willing to help with the removal of copper lines or
cables. Telkom is currently replacing copper based cables
with fiber optic cables but it’s clear that they are having a hard time keeping up with the ‘copper
grabbers.’
